Purpose SpineLineTM, a peer-reviewed publication of the North American Spine Society, is published bimonthly to educate and inform NASS members on medical, ethical and policy matters in the field of spine and health care. SpineLine serves as the primary publication for the NASS membership: (1) to educate and inform NASS’ multidisciplinary members on issues of interest and relevance to spine care and research, and assist them in providing quality, cost-effective patient care; and (2) to communicate and promote the policies, professional activities and products of the association.

Statements or opinions expressed in SpineLine are those of the author(s) and do not necessarily represent positions of the North American Spine Society.
